Sun 05 Dec 2010 01:41:47 AM UTC, original submission:

1) Some commands get not recorded if the [x]-field is checked in the Scheme Script window. These seem to be only Scheme commands (so far).
Recording can be tested by enabled the checkbox and click on the menu item with your mouse.

For example Double-Barline or Line Break do not produce a recorded entry.

2) For built-in commands the recording function writes the name of the menu item to the script (d-Xyz) which is great.
But for (most of the) Scheme commands it does the same as Rightclick->Get Script. This means it just inserts the whole script to the scheme window.

[x]Record should record those short menu names for scheme commands, too.

Current situation is contra-productive to our promise that users don't need any programming skills to write scripts. They get to see the whole script, loose overview (just imagine someone wants to use paste!) and accidentally delete a closing parentheses, which is futile for Scheme :)

Even scheme commands have the same simple name (d-Abc) and can be called with it.
